11:23Now PlayingIn this explosive NIGHT SCHOOL episode, Marc Lamont Hill hosts former NFL wide receiver Donté Stallworth (@DonteStallworth) and radical sports journalist Dave Zirin (@EdgeofSports) to discuss the NFL's hidden truths. Stallworth and Zirin pull no punches as they expose systemic racism within the league, the racial barriers for black coaches, and the hypocrisy behind the "Black Anthem." Stallworth, a fearless writer and thinker, reveals insider stories and untold player revolts against anthem mandates. Meanwhile, Zirin dissects the deep-rooted white supremacy logic that pervades the NFL, drawing powerful parallels between sports and society.
